
Springer Handbook of Automation
by Shimon Y. Nof
1812 pages· 2009· ISBN 9783540788317
About
This handbook incorporates new developments in automation. It also presents a widespread and well-structured conglomeration of new emerging application areas, such as medical systems and health, transportation, security and maintenance, service, construction and retail as well as production or logistics. The handbook is not only an ideal resource for automation experts but also for people new to this expanding field.
